Output d62e417c20bf3b7cdce321bee89a07c1aaa5cfaaf10a0acd8483d96595035c26:0

value
38283883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c56912641da2c632f2fad8ce6b7e565564b33af7 OP_EQUAL
address
MRtyDjtMbV9u3pZnrdzoQDYi6vQqwCWczB
transaction
d62e417c20bf3b7cdce321bee89a07c1aaa5cfaaf10a0acd8483d96595035c26
spent
true